探索Intune Shell脚本宝库:提升设备管理的艺术
项目介绍
欢迎来到Intune Customer Experience Engineering Shell Script Repo,这是一个由微软Intune客户体验工程团队维护的开源项目。本仓库汇集了大量用于macOS和Linux设备的Shell脚本示例,旨在帮助用户更好地理解和利用Intune进行设备管理。无论你是IT管理员、开发者还是技术爱好者,这些脚本都能为你提供丰富的教育资源和实践机会。
项目技术分析
技术栈
- Shell脚本:本项目主要使用Shell脚本语言,这是一种广泛应用于Unix/Linux和macOS系统的脚本语言,具有强大的系统管理和自动化能力。
- Intune:微软的Intune是一款基于云的设备管理解决方案,支持企业对移动设备、桌面和应用进行集中管理。
目录结构
项目按照操作系统分为两个主要部分:
-
Linux:
Config
:配置相关的脚本。Custom Compliance
:自定义合规性设置的脚本。Misc
:其他杂项脚本。
-
macOS:
Apps
:应用管理相关的脚本。Config
:配置相关的脚本。Custom Attributes
:自定义属性的脚本。Custom Profiles
:自定义配置文件的脚本。
项目及技术应用场景
应用场景
- 企业设备管理:IT管理员可以使用这些脚本自动化设备配置、应用部署和合规性检查,提升管理效率。
- 教育机构:学校和培训机构可以利用这些脚本快速配置和管理学生和教职工的设备。
- 开发者工具:开发者可以参考这些脚本,学习如何编写高效的Shell脚本,并将其应用于自己的项目中。
技术应用
- 自动化配置:通过Shell脚本自动化设备的初始配置,减少手动操作的错误和时间成本。
- 合规性检查:使用自定义合规性脚本确保设备符合企业的安全标准。
- 应用管理:自动化应用的安装、更新和卸载,确保所有设备上的应用版本一致。
项目特点
- 丰富的示例:项目提供了大量针对macOS和Linux设备的Shell脚本示例,涵盖了从基础配置到高级应用管理的各个方面。
- 开源社区支持:项目欢迎社区贡献,用户可以通过提交Pull Request来分享自己的脚本和改进建议。
- 易于扩展:脚本结构清晰,易于理解和修改,用户可以根据自己的需求进行定制和扩展。
- 官方支持:由微软Intune团队维护,确保脚本的质量和可靠性。
结语
Intune Customer Experience Engineering Shell Script Repo不仅是一个脚本仓库,更是一个学习和实践的平台。无论你是初学者还是资深开发者,这里都有你需要的资源。立即访问项目仓库,开启你的设备管理自动化之旅吧!